What companies run services between Elephant & Castle Station, Greater London, England and High Barnet Station, England?

London Underground (Tube) operates a subway from Elephant & Castle station to High Barnet station every 10 minutes. Tickets cost £12–50 and the journey takes 43 min. Alternatively, you can take a bus from Heygate Street to High Barnet Station via Trafalgar Square in around 1h 42m.
